~Menu ONE~
This is sweets called 'Lokum'. In English, is called 'Turkish delight'.
This is made of sugar, starch and nuts(walnuts, almond, coconuts, for example).
And this is like a rice cake of Japan.
It's very sweet.
There are various lokum by the region.

~Menu TWO~
This is also popular sweets in Japan.
This is ice cream called 'Dondurma'.
It's sold as 'Turkish Ice' in Japan.
Like this right picture, this ice cream is stretched.
It's fun, isn't it?
Basic taste is a sweet milk or vanilla flavor, but there are coffee and chocolate tastes.
